Kristjana S. Williams at The Map House

February 16, 2023by themaphouse

From 10th March to 21st April, Icelandic artist Kristjana S Williams will once again be exhibiting her extraordinary and immersive map-based artwork at London’s oldest map specialist, The Map House.
